Specimen Requirements

Specimen Type: Urine
Container/Tube: Urine cup
Volume: 100.0 mL
Minimum Volume: 30.0 mL
Collection Instructions: Collect first-morning (preferred) urine as it contains the highest concentration of beta-hCG.

Reference Interval

Interpretation of urine hCG result should take into consideration potential false negatives in:
(a) patients > 5 weeks or < 12 days pregnant
(b) ectopic and molar pregnancy
(c) diluted urine

 

And false positives in:
(d) urinary tract infection and/or haematuria
(e) patients treated with antibody therapy
(f) nephrotic syndrome
(g) urine admixed with cleaning solutions/detergents

 

In these cases, a serum beta-HCG is recommended.
